When sociology informs medicine: the consultant neurologist

Consultant neurologist Bridget MacDonald talks to Kathy Oxtoby about how she incorporates sociology and anthropology into her medical practice

Bridget MacDonald enjoys demystifying neurology for the patients she cares for and the doctors she trains. “I love being able to explain things in a way that people understand and that diffuses their anxieties,” she says.

As a consultant neurologist with a special interest in epilepsy at Croydon University Hospital and St George’s Hospital in London, she is inspired by those in her care. “My patients have taught me so much how they deal with their disabilities, how they make the best of what they’ve been dealt and enjoy what there is to enjoy in life.”
